
Other properties in Italy
Similar Hotels
Italy
| Sanremo

La Foresteria del Convento
Italy
| Santarcangelo di Romagna

Hotel Canada
Italy
| Venice

Hotel Legnano
Italy
| Legnano

Hotel Rurale Orti di Nora & SPA
Italy
| Santa Margherita di Pula